Many houses here date from the 1910s to 1940s and still carry original wood or early aluminum siding. Cold winters cause boards to cup and fasteners to loosen while humid summers speed paint failure. Siding Contractor in West Central — Local Notes
- •Older balloon-frame homes along Berry Street often need furring strips added before new siding to correct wavy walls.
- •Tight rear access on many West Central lots requires hand-carrying materials instead of using boom trucks.
- •South-facing walls near Swinney Park receive extra UV exposure and need upgraded fasteners to prevent warping in hot summers.
- •Winter wind tunnels between close-set houses increase ice-dam risk at eaves, so we check and improve attic ventilation during every siding job.
